Era / Decade
1960s-1970s (Mid-Century Modern). This pattern was heavily produced during this period to capitalize on the organic texture trend.
Material
Pressed avocado/emerald green glass. It is a thick, durable soda-lime glass with a mold-pressed "bark" or crinkle texture.

Authenticity Indicators
The Soreno pattern is iconic to Anchor Hocking; look for a smooth interior and very rough, textured exterior. It is rarely marked (stickers were used originally). Confidence Level: High.
Flaws to Note
Potential for small 'flea bites' or chips around the inner rim; hard water deposits/cloudiness inside the base (can usually be cleaned with vinegar); manufacturing bubbles common in glass of this era.
